Need Help - Tripod Screw Stuck!

I'm an amateur filmmaker and just came across a problem.
I attached a decent sized tripod to my camera, a Canon XH-A1. When I was done with it, the tripod wouldn't release and eventually the screw got snapped off and left inside of the camera. Now I have a small piece of metal stuck inside and I can't find a way to get it out =(
Any suggestions?
